Jay Gul is an Associate Lecturer at Deakin Law School, Faculty of Business and Law, Deakin University, located at the Melbourne Burwood Campus in Australia. He has previously served as a lecturer at Hong Kong Polytechnic University and other Hong Kong institutions, including through the University of Northumbria Newcastle’s Faculty of Business and Law via the Hong Kong Vocational Training Council.
Education:
- LLB, University of London
- LLM in Law, City University, London, UK
- PhD (in progress) on 'Law and Migrant Domestic Workers in Hong Kong', Monash University, Melbourne
Jay Gul's research centers on Labour Law, Migration Law, Human Rights Law, International Law, Commercial Law, and Business Ethics. His work critically examines employment protections, judicial reasoning in labour disputes, and legal frameworks affecting migrant workers in Hong Kong. His teaching interests align closely with his research, including Commercial Laws, Employment/Labour Laws, and Business Ethics.
His recent publications focus on corporate governance and employee rights in Hong Kong and China, revealing trends in legal compliance, statutory benefit evasion, and judicial accountability. These works contribute to comparative legal studies and policy discussions on worker protections in urban Asian economies.
